Is Solar Power Compatible with Cage Systems in Poultry Farming?
With the increasing demand for renewable energy, many poultry farmers are exploring alternative energy sources, including solar power. This article delves into the compatibility of solar power with cage systems in the poultry industry.
Understanding Solar Power Integration
Before discussing compatibility, it’s crucial to understand how solar power systems can be integrated into poultry farming.
- Direct Integration: Solar panels can be installed on the roofs of poultry houses or in open areas adjacent to the farm.
- Indirect Integration: The power generated can be fed back into the grid or used directly on the farm for various purposes, including cage system operations.
Benefits of Solar Power in Poultry Farming
Solar power offers several benefits that can enhance the efficiency and sustainability of poultry farming:
- Cost Savings: Reducing electricity bills by harnessing free solar energy.
- Environmental Impact: Lowering the carbon footprint of the farm by reducing reliance on fossil fuels.
- Energy Independence: Increasing the farm’s autonomy and reducing vulnerability to energy price fluctuations.
Compatibility with Cage Systems
Is solar power compatible with cage systems? The answer is a resounding yes. Here’s why:
- Reduced Energy Consumption: Solar power can significantly reduce the energy required for ventilation, lighting, and heating in cage systems.
- Reliability: Solar power systems provide a consistent and reliable energy supply, essential for maintaining optimal cage conditions.
- Scalability: Solar power systems can be easily scaled up or down to match the energy needs of different cage systems.
Case Studies and Statistics
Several case studies have demonstrated the effectiveness of solar power in poultry farming. For instance, a poultry farm in China reported a 30% reduction in electricity bills after installing a 500kW solar power system. Similarly, a study by the International Journal of Environmental Research and Public Health revealed that solar power integration can lead to a 20% reduction in greenhouse gas emissions from poultry farms.
Parameter | Impact of Solar Power Integration |
---|---|
Electricity Bills | Reduction of up to 30% |
Greenhouse Gas Emissions | Reduction of up to 20% |
Energy Consumption | Reduction of up to 30% |
These figures highlight the significant potential of solar power in enhancing the sustainability and profitability of poultry farming operations.
